5. How to Make Hufflepuff Honeycomb Butterbeer Treats

Step 1: Prepare Your Workspace

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or a silicone baking mat. Have your ingredients measured and ready — precision is key for that perfect honeycomb rise and texture.

Step 2: Make the Honeycomb Base

In a heavy-bottomed saucepan, combine honey, golden syrup, and butter. Cook over medium heat, stirring constantly, until the mixture reaches 300°F (hard crack stage). You’ll notice a deep amber color and a fragrant aroma. Immediately remove from heat and quickly stir in baking soda—it will fizz up dramatically, creating the signature bubbly structure. Pour the mixture onto your prepared sheet and spread evenly with a spatula. Let it cool until firm and crispy.

Step 3: Assemble the Butterbeer Flavor

While the honeycomb cools, prepare a butterbeer syrup by gently heating cream, butter, and vanilla extracts, infusing it with cozy, caramel undertones. Once cooled slightly, crumble the honeycomb into bite-sized pieces and toss with the syrup mixture so the flavors meld beautifully.

Step 4: Final Assembly

Spread the coated honeycomb pieces into individual serving cups or bowls. Drizzle with extra butterbeer syrup or whipped cream for an extra decadent touch. Garnish with edible gold flakes or tiny wizard hats for an authentic Harry Potter vibe.

6. Expert Tips for Success

  • Use a candy thermometer to hit the precise temperature for perfect honeycomb consistency—undercooking or overcooking can ruin the texture.
  • Work quickly after adding baking soda; the mixture sets fast, so pour and spread immediately.
  • Grease your spatula or spatulas to prevent sticking and ensure smooth spreading.
  • Store in an airtight container at room temperature for a week—just beware of moisture that can soften the crunch.

8. Storage & Reheating

Honeycomb treats stay crisp in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. Avoid refrigerating, as moisture will soften them. If they become a little soft, re-crisp by warming in a low oven for a few minutes—just watch carefully to prevent over-melting.

9. FAQ

Can I make honeycomb without a candy thermometer?

While a thermometer provides perfect accuracy, you can also perform the “cold water test”: When the syrup reaches a deep amber color, drop a small spoonful in cold water; if it hardens and crumbles, it’s ready.

Hufflepuff Honeycomb Butterbeer Treats

5 Stars 4 Stars 3 Stars 2 Stars 1 Star

No reviews

A sweet and crunchy honeycomb treat infused with the rich flavors of butterbeer, perfect for Harry Potter fans looking to bring a piece of magical wizardry to their snack table.

  • Total Time: 20 minutes
  • Yield: 12 treats

Ingredients

  • 1 cup honey
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/4 cup butterbeer flavoring or extract

Instructions

  1.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per and set aside.
  2. In a saucepan, combine honey, sugar, and butter over medium heat. Stir until the mixture reaches 300°F (hard crack stage).
  3. Remove from heat and quickly stir in baking soda and vanilla extract. The mixture will foam up.
  4. Pour the mixture onto the prepared baking sheet and spread evenly. Let it cool and harden.
  5. Burst into pieces and drizzle with butterbeer sauce if desired. Serve immediately or store in an airtight container.

Notes

  • Use a candy thermometer for accurate temperature.
  • Store in an airtight container for up to one week.
